Output 20684207855290e57e804d94e52c009af8ce5b1bbbbea0a7c9f07c7040fcd73f:1

value
10315950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4246e878befaa46283be4a5d1eeaca2d3b31bc0c OP_EQUAL
address
37jTTz6THkSrafDNa6H3t5F7yuTpfWPqGY
transaction
20684207855290e57e804d94e52c009af8ce5b1bbbbea0a7c9f07c7040fcd73f
spent
true